Hspb6 - heat shock protein, alpha-crystallin-related, B6 Gene
Also Known as Gm479; Hsp20
Species: Mus musculus
Summary
Predicted to enable chaperone binding activity; protein homodimerization activity; and unfolded protein binding activity. Predicted to be involved in chaperone-mediated protein folding; negative regulation of cardiac muscle cell apoptotic process; and positive regulation of angiogenesis. Predicted to be located in several cellular components, including Golgi apparatus; cytosol; and nucleolus. Is expressed in brain subventricular zone; lung; retina inner nuclear layer; retina outer nuclear layer; and smooth muscle tissue. Orthologous to human HSPB6 (heat shock protein family B (small) member 6). [provided by Alliance of Genome Resources, Apr 2022]
